TPWD's Annual Public Hunting Permit opens access to state lands

Texas hunters can pay for a single annual permit to access public hunting lands across the state, including areas near Parker County.

TPWD sells an Annual Public Hunting (APH) Permit that lets you hunt on about one million acres of state land. The permit covers deer, hogs, dove, quail, turkey, waterfowl, and small game across more than 180 areas.

The permit also allows fishing, camping, and hiking on those same lands. A limited version costs less and covers only non-hunting access. Most public hunting land in this part of Texas is in adjacent counties — check the TPWD public hunting lands map booklet each season for which areas are open near Parker County. The permit is not a substitute for a hunting license.
